Zillow Group HqfK35 Jun 19, 2022

I did mech to swe without a degree or any cert, just did free online tutorials and some 10 dollar udemy classes. I eventually landed a job at a crappy startup that had use for someone with both coding and mech skills. I took advantage to get as much coding experience as possible for a few years and then got a job at a real tech company

Amazon jstlookina Jun 19, 2022

I was a mechanical engineer and am now a SWE. I took about 4 core classes in undergrad for CS and then one grad level course. Got a referral, leetcoded hard, and got the offer.
